  • Sculptural paintings

    The artworks in this series demonstrate an exploration into the relationship between artist and material.

    Chris gets most excited when he starts to see the pre-used building materials and art supplies morphing into one another. This creates a gap in his work as an alignment between intention, process and technique breaks down. It is this gap which makes the outcome of each artwork exciting and interesting. This working process reinvents the pre-used building materials allowing them to become something else and enabling a new beginning as a work of art.
